This refers to the inspection conducted by G. L. Troup of this office on April 21-

25, 1980 of activities authorized by NRC License Nos. NPF-2 and CPPR-86 for the

Farley facility, and to the discussion of our findings held with W. G. Hairston,

III at the conclusion of the inspection.

Areas examined during the inspection and our findings are discussed in the

i

enclosed inspection report. Within these areas, the inspection consisted of

selective examinations of procedures and representative records, interviews with

personnel, and observations by the inspectors.

In accordance with Section 2.790 of the NRC's " Rules of Practice", Part 2,

Title 10, Code of Federal Regulations, a copy of this letter and the enclosed

inspection report will be placed in the NRC's Public Document Room.

If this

report contains any information that you (or ycur contractor) believe to be

proprietary, it is necessary that you make a written application within 20 days

to this office to withhold such information from public disclosure. Any such

application must include a full statement of the reasons on the basis of which

it is claimed that the information is proprietary, and should be prepared so

that proprietary information identified in the application is contained in a

separate part of the document.

If we do not hear from you in this regard within

the specified period, the report will be placed in the Public Document Room.

Should you have any questions concerning this letter, we will be glad to discuss

them with you.
